Details on the Postage Rate Increase
The Postal Service did publish a full chart [3] early in the year with predicted rates (note: the free Adobe Reader [4] is required for viewing this document). Based on reports, the increase will only be one cent for first-class mail to 34 cents; additional ounces would go from 22 cents to 23 cents each.

The exact rate increase may be known after the Board of Governors meets Nov. 13-14.
